Man held for killing police officer-father

Gurugram, Oct 3 (IANS) A 22-year-old man with criminal history was on Tuesday arrested for gunning down his father-cum-Haryana Police officer who objected to his "criminal activities", police said.

The body of Assistant Sub-Inspector Naresh Kumar Yadav, bearing a gunshot injury, was found at his residence in U block of DLF Phase 3, an officer said. His son was found missing.

Yadav, 44, was posted in Faridabad. Police have arrested Yadav’s son Mohit from Jaipur. "He will be produced before a court on Wednesday," a police officer said.

The accused has a history of involvement in murder, attempt to murder, theft and snatching.

Several FIRs have been registered against Mohit at various police stations in Gurugram and outside the district.

"Police officer Yadav often objected against the criminal activities of his son and scolded him on several occasions. Mohit killed his father for scolding him," the officer added.
